About:
We are a leading law firm seeking an experienced Business Analyst to join our team. Our firm utilizes cutting-edge technology solutions including Litify (Salesforce), ClickUp, Tableau, and JazzHR to streamline our operations and deliver exceptional service to our clients. We're looking for a data-driven professional who can help us leverage these tools to optimize our business processes and drive performance across all departments.
Responsibilities:
Review and analyze individual, departmental, and company-wide performance data
Identify and track trends, developing and maintaining company-wide reporting
Design and implement strategies for measuring departmental productivity based on daily activities and final outcomes
Create and produce daily, weekly, monthly, quarterly, and year-to-date analyses for Managers, Directors, and the CEO's office
Develop departmental dashboards that capture trends and performance of each employee, providing insights and proposed solutions for improvement
Identify performance and process gaps, recommending areas for improvement
Collaborate with teams to gather requirements for new reporting requests
Record and raise issues that hamper productivity, collaborate with department heads to overcome constraints
Develop reporting tools and dashboards to increase productivity across the firm
Ensure compliance, quality, consistency, and timely delivery of reports, dashboards, and business intelligence
Collect and analyze performance data against defined parameters
Communicate complex data insights in clear, actionable ways to various stakeholders.
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in business administration, Data Science, or a related field
Master of Business Administration preferred
Minimum of 5 years of experience as a Business or Data Analyst, preferably in a legal or professional services environment
Strong proficiency in Litify (Salesforce), ClickUp, Tableau, and JazzHR
Experience with additional tools such as Zapier, Google Sheets, Greenhouse, CVent, Bizzabo, HubSpot, and ChurnZero is a plus
Proven track record of structuring large sets of data, data modeling, and creating meaningful, concise reports for leadership teams
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
Strong communication skills, with the ability to present complex data in an easy-to-understand format
Experience working with firms generating over $20M in revenue is preferred
Background in Business Process Optimization (BPO) is a plus
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ment
Strong attention to detail and commitment to data accuracy
The ideal candidate will have a background similar to professionals from top consulting firms such as Accenture, Cognizant, PwC, McKinsey, Deloitte, or EY. They should possess the technical skills of a data analyst and quality assurance professional, combined with the guidance and leadership experience of a manager.

Benefits:
Financial Benefits
401k Contributions: The firm offers a discretionary match up to 5%. This includes a 100% match on the first 3% of contributions and a 50% match on the next 2%, based on annual compensation.
Charitable Donations: The Chaffin Luhana Foundation makes an annual donation to a charity of each team member’s choice.
Healthcare Benefits
Medical Insurance: $503 toward monthly health premiums for team members or their families. Team members pay just $1.
Dental Insurance: Full coverage, with only a $1 monthly contribution from the team member.
Vision Insurance: Full coverage, with only a $1 monthly contribution from the team member.
Health Reimbursement Account (HRA): Team members receive a $1,000 contribution from the firm in their HRA account if enrolled in the PPO health plan.
Family / Dependent Care (DCR): Team members can contribute up to $5,000 pre-tax for dependent care.
Flex Spending Account (FSA): Team members can contribute up to $1,000 pre-tax for medical expenses.
Commuter Benefits
Tax-free Transit Commute (TRN): Team members can contribute up to $325 per month pre-tax toward transit tickets.
Discounted Parking (PKG): Team members can contribute up to $325 per month pre-tax toward parking.
Time Off to Recharge & Renew
Paid Time Off (PTO): 15 PTO days per year, increasing to 20 days after 3 years with the firm.
Sick Days: 3 paid sick days per year.
Celebrate the Holidays: Office is closed for 10 public holidays.
Office Closure: Office is typically closed between Christmas and New Year’s Day.
Culture & Development of Team
Casual Dress: Enjoy our business casual dress code.
Enhance Your Skills: Up to $500 annually for continued education or training.
Learn How You’re Wired: Take a Kolbe Assessment to learn your instinctive method of operation.
Time Management: Time management luncheons with senior leadership to elevate team and organizational success.
Free Workouts: Free access to GreenTree SportsPlex for Pittsburgh office.
Recognition at the Firm
Value Team Members: Bonusly points for peer-to-peer recognition, redeemable for gift cards, trips, dinners, and more.
Eat, Drink & Be Merry: Free team lunches and happy hours.
Annual Bonus: Year-end discretionary bonus.
Firm Outing: Annual firm outing for all team members to meet up and have fun.
